Output df2c766863b6adb3fb8fec0ce41946abe7b5cd35e096ab5dc0d51078d1ea4e17:13

value
28385195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e53e27808e305d461c4a0f60568ddac659c6087 OP_EQUAL
address
MAfWzbJvLLeBLsw7uYfx1ghSGA2aCnfLNR
transaction
df2c766863b6adb3fb8fec0ce41946abe7b5cd35e096ab5dc0d51078d1ea4e17
spent
true